「Docker」に関連する技術ブログ

企業やコミュニティが発信する「Docker」に関連する技術ブログの一覧です。

AWS IoT Greengrass と Docker を使用した IoT ソリューションのラピッドプロトタイピングのパターン

この記事は Patterns for rapid IoT solution prototyping using AWS IoT Greengrass and Docker の日本語訳です。 はじめに 調査によると、モノのインターネット(IoT)ソリューションの実装には、通常、市場に出て運用準備が整うまでに 平均18〜24か月 かかります。IoT ソリューション開発に関連する一般的なシナリオには、デバイスプロビジョニング、テレメトリ収集、リモートコマンドアン

Creating a Development Environment Using VS Code's Dev Container

A sequel article has been posted 🥳🎉 (June 8, 2023): [Sequel! Dev Container] Creating a cloud development environment with GitHub Codespaces . Introduction Hello. Torii here, from the team[^1][^2] Common Services Development Group that develops payment platforms used by multiple services. Finding your IDE doesn't work even though you created it according to the procedure manual; having to check how different-version SDKs work and install them separately for each product; and so on... I

MLOps1年目 - SageMakerを使う中で苦労した課題解決とこれからの展望

はじめに 以前のテックブログまでにやったことと課題 各課題とその解決策の分析 特徴量の再利用性の低さ 学習にかかる時間の長期化 単一モデルデプロイフローしか整備されていない パイプライン実行の煩雑化 PoCからシステムへの初期導入のリードタイムの長期化 これまでの取り組み 特徴量の再利用性の低さ 学習にかかる時間の長期化 単一モデルのデプロイフローし

PostgreSQLのレプリケーション環境をDockerで手軽に立ち上げてみる

こんにちは。 エンジニアの nobushi です。 RDBを扱うWebアプリケーションを構築しているとRDBのレプリケーション環境を必要とすることもあると思います。 アプリケーション側で対応が必要なのでできれば開発を行うローカル環境の段階で導入したいところです。 そこで今回は手軽にローカルのdocker-composeでRDBのレプリケーション環境を構築してみたいと思います。 使用す

Dockerイメージの中身を理解する

はじめに こんにちは、開発課に所属している新卒 1 年目のke-suke0215です。 Dockerのイメージについて「なんとなく業務で使っているけど、いまいちどうなっているのかわかっていない」という状態だったので、今回はDockerイメージの中身がどのように構成されているのかについて調べてみました。 私のようなDockerをなんとなく使っている方が仕組みを理解する手助けになれ

MacでLimaを使ってDockerを動かしてみた

カイポケの SRE 担当の有賀です。 社内では Mac で Docker Desktop を使うのが標準的になっている中、 Docker Desktop 以外の選択肢も試してみようと思い、 Docker Desktop や、社内で使っている人のいた Rancher Desktop を調べはじめました。その仕組みを調べている中で Rancher Desktop が採用している Lima がGUIを利用しない用途だと必要十分と感じたため、 Lima を使うことにしました。 Macを

最新!この一週間でもっとも読まれた記事|2023.9.26~10.2 PV数ランキングTOP10

はじめに こんにちは!「 SHIFTGroup技術ブログ 」編集部です。 いつもご覧いただきありがとうございます。 2020年5月から立ち上げて以来、250名を超える公式ブロガーとともに累計900本以上のオリジナル記事を発信している本ブログですが、これまでさまざまなジャンルの記事をお届けしてまいりました。

ROSConJP 2023の参加報告と「ROS開発効率化ソリューション」のご紹介

はじめに アプトポッドVPoPの岩田です。 昨日、浅草の都立産業技術センター台東館にて行われた ROSConJP 2023 にて、シルバースポンサーとしてブース出展をしてまいりました。ブースでは、当社の主力製品であるIoTプラットフォームミドルウェアintdashをROS開発に応用した、ROS開発ワークフローの効率化パッケージについてご紹介しました。 YouTubeのリアルタイム配信をご覧

【連載 ROS Tips】ROS開発におけるDocker活用テクニック

アプトポッド組み込みエンジニアの久保田です。 近年、ロボットやモビリティを動作させるためのプラットフォームとしてROSを採用することが多くなってきています。 通常、ROSは特定のUbuntuバージョンに対応したディストリビューションとしてリリースされていますので、ROSのディストリビューションを変更したい場合は、ホストOSも変更する必要があります。この制約

ECS起動を高速化するSeekable OCI(SOCI)インデックスをGitHub Actionsでも作る

SOCIとは? SOCI(Seekable OCI)はAWSが開発しているコンテナイメージの遅延読み込みのための仕組みです。コンテナイメージには起動時には使わないデータも多く含まれています。遅延読み込みによって、起動時には最小限のデータのみ読み込んで起動時間を短縮することを目的としています。コンテナ起動時の遅延読み込み自体は以前から存在しており、有名なものに estargz が

mac環境にてmultipassとdevcontainerでcdk開発環境を作成する

初めに 試したmacの環境: 本記事の対象者 1. multipassをインストールする 2. multipassでdocker用のVMの作成と環境整備 3. vscodeでdocker-vmに接続する 4. VM内でdevcontainerを作成する 5. 実際にCDKを作成してsynthしてみる 6. devcontainerにgitのconfigや鍵をマウントする 7.まとめ 初めに CS1の石井です。 突然自分語りから入ってしまうのですが、私は子供の頃からよく物を壊してしまいます。扱

Pyroscope の Continuous Profiling により Go サーバーのメモリリークを調査・改善した話

はじめに 子育てメディア「トモニテ」でバックエンドやフロントエンドの設計・開発を担当している桝村です。 2023年8月1日、MAMADAYSはトモニテに生まれかわりました。 tomonite.com アプリのメイン機能である「育児記録」「妊娠週数管理」「食材リスト」を軸として、家族やパートナー、家族以外の人や社会との接点を作るためのシェア機能やコミュニティ機能などの拡充

【連載 ROS Tips】そもそもROSとは?

はじめに: ROS Tipsの連載投稿はじめます アプトポッドVPoPの岩田です。 近年、ロボット技術が急速に進化していますが、その背景にはROS(Robot Operating System)というミドルウェアの存在が大きく影響しています。特に、ROSの新しいバージョンである「ROS 2」がリリースされて以来、ロボット開発の現場でもますます注目度が高まっています。ROSは元々、研究や学術用途で広く

AWS Outposts Server (Graviton2, Xeon) 電力効率検証

はじめに こんにちは、イノベーションセンターの鈴ヶ嶺です。 普段はクラウドサービスをオンプレミス環境でも同様のUI/UXで使用できるハイブリッドクラウド製品の技術検証をしています。 我々は以下のように過去にAWSのサーバ型ハイブリッドクラウドの解説や実施検証などを行ってきました。 engineers.ntt.com engineers.ntt.com このたび、新たにAWS Graviton2搭載のOutposts Serverを
技術ブログを絞り込む

TECH PLAY でイベントをはじめよう

グループを作れば、無料で誰でもイベントページが作成できます。情報発信や交流のためのイベントをTECH PLAY で公開してみませんか?